<B>1868 $20 Liberty Head Double Eagle, Judd-665, Pollock-740, Low R.7, PR64 PCGS.</B></I> The regular issue design for the Liberty double eagle. Struck in aluminum with a reeded edge. Approximately six examples of this pattern variety are known, including those that were or are part of cased aluminum coinage sets. Four pieces were mentioned by Andrew Pollock III, including the Bass, Garrett, and Farouk coins and one that was offered in Bowers and Merena's September 1984 sale. This particular example has attractive light gray surfaces with reflective fields. A small mark is visible on Liberty's chin, and a few small planchet imperfections are evident on the reverse.
